26、cutters ENISO77872:2000 ISO -78772:(0002)Ev Introduction This part of ISO 7787 is one of a series of standards relating to dental rotary instruments. The various dimensional and other requirements specified for carbide laboratory cutters are those considered important to ensure the interchangeabilit

27、y and safe usage of these instruments in the dental laboratory. The nominal diameters of the working part listed in Tables 1 to 11 comply with the diameters specified in ISO 2157, Dental rotary instruments Nominal diameters and designation code number. Attention is drawn to ISO 6360, which specifies

28、 a 15-digit number coding system for the identification of dental rotary instruments of all types. 35、he purposes of this part of ISO 7787, the following symbols apply. d diameter of working part, head diameter; l length of working part, head length; angle of working part. 5 Requirements 5.1 Materials 5.1.1 Working part The working part shall be made of tungsten carbide. The selection of the type of

36、 tungsten carbide and its treatment are at the discretion of the manufacturer. 5.1.2 Shank The material of the shank shall comply with ISO 1797-1. 5.2 Shapes The shapes of the working part shall be as specified in Figures 1 to 11. Variations of the shapes are permitted within the limited dimensions

37、and the descriptions used in the subclause titles. Testing shall be carried out in accordance with 6.1. 5.3 Dimensions and number of blades 5.3.1 Working part 5.3.1.1 General Dimensions are given in millimetres and angles are given in degrees. The dimensions of the working part shall be as specified

38、 in Figures 1 to 11 as appropriate and Tables 1 to 11 as appropriate. The number of blades shall be as specified in Table 12. Testing shall be carried out in accordance with 6.2. 45、 ISO 1797-1. 5.4 Toothing The toothing of the instruments in Figures 1 to 11 is shown as examples only. The selection of toothing is left to the discretion of the manufacturer. For the designation of toothing, see clause 8 and Table 12. Testing shall be carried out in accordance with 6.3. 5.5 Run-ou

46、t The total indicated run-out shall not exceed 0,08 mm. Testing shall be carried out in accordance with 6.4. 6 Test procedures 6.1 Shapes Determine the shapes by using a shadowgraph or measuring the relevant dimensions in accordance with ISO 8325. 6.2 Dimensions and number of blades Measure the dime

47、nsions in accordance with ISO 8325. Determine the number of blades by visual inspection. ENISO77872:2000 ISO -78772:(0002)E9 6.3 Toothing Determine the type of toothing by visual inspection. 6.4 Run-out Determine the run-out in accordance with ISO 8325. The measurement point shall be at the largest

48、diameter or, for cylindrical cutters, the middle of the working part. 7 Sampling and acceptance level (AQL) The acceptable quality level (AQL) in accordance with ISO 2859-1 shall be 6,5. 8 Designation of toothing and number of blades The toothing shall be designated by any of the following information, or any combination thereof:
